At the Pacific Region Convention, on April 28, 2:30 pm, botanical artist, Dyana Hesson, will be speaking about her unique style of botanical artwork. Learn about her creative process through stories, photos, and videos, and get a sneak peek at the work she is preparing for her 2025 one-woman show.

Dyana loves a good adventure. “I simply can’t get enough of Arizona, its sun on my face, its dirt under my feet, its colors on my pallet. The Grand Canyon state has been generous with inspiration for my many years as an artist, and I’m just getting started. There’s always more to explore around the next bend.”

Driven by curiosity and discovery, Dyana is on a mission to paint every wild Arizona plant she can find. Beyond the attention-grabbing prickly pear and saguaro, she also loves painting the little plants and blooms found in Arizona’s backcountry. Placing her subjects in the landscape helps her collectors feel the moment of discovery and thus, enter into the adventure.

Her latest project, Wild Arizona, will celebrate her thirty-five years as a painter, unveiling the largest collection of her works seen publicly in years. The Arizona Sonora Desert Museum’s Ironwood Gallery will host Dyana’s exhibit October 3-December 7, 2025.

Her one-hour talk will be followed by time for questions and a book signing of her latest book, “The Art of Wildflowers”. You can learn more about Dyana’s artwork at DyanaHesson.com
